Understand Local Search Intent

 

To rank higher on Google, it’s essential to understand the intent behind local searches. Consider the specific needs and preferences of your local audience. Are they looking for nearby businesses, specific services, or local recommendations? 

 

Understanding their search intent will help you identify the right keywords to target.

 

Identify Localized Keywords

 

When conducting keyword research, focus on identifying localized keywords that align with your business’s location. Simply incorporate your city, town, or region name into your target keywords. 

 

For instance, if you run a bakery in Brooklyn, consider using keywords like “best bakery in Brooklyn” or “cupcakes in Williamsburg, Brooklyn.” These localized keywords will help you attract customers who are actively searching for businesses in your area.

 

Utilize Long-Tail Keywords

 

Long-tail keywords are specific phrases that cater to more specific search queries. They often have lower competition and higher conversion potential, making them important targets for increasing your rank on Google.

 

Incorporate long-tail keywords into your strategy by adding descriptive terms that your local customers are likely to use. For example, “organic grocery store in downtown Denver” or “family-friendly restaurants near Central Park, New York City.” Long-tail keywords help you capture the attention of customers who are looking for precisely what your business offers.

 

Optimize Your Website

 

Once you have identified your target keywords, it’s crucial to optimize your website accordingly. This means incorporating your localized and long-tail keywords naturally into your page titles, headings, meta descriptions, and body content.

 

Additionally, it’s a good idea to optimize your website’s loading speed, mobile responsiveness, and user experience to improve your chances of ranking higher on Google.

 

Leverage Google My Business

 

Google My Business (GMB) is a powerful tool for local businesses to enhance their online presence. So, create a GMB listing and ensure that your business name, address, and phone number (NAP) are consistent across all online platforms.

 

Once you have it up and running, you’ll want to encourage customers to leave reviews, respond to reviews promptly, and regularly update your GMB profile with relevant information. Optimizing your GMB listing will improve your chances of appearing in the coveted local pack and Google Maps results.

 

Build Local Backlinks

 

Backlinks from reputable local sources can significantly impact your local search rankings. So, seek opportunities to build relationships with local organizations, bloggers, or influencers who can link back to your website. You may also want to participate in local events, sponsor community initiatives, or offer to contribute guest posts on local websites. 

 

These local backlinks demonstrate your relevance and authority within the local community, boosting your chances of ranking higher on Google.
